Publisher SEO requires a multi-layered approach that differs significantly from traditional website optimization. Publishers must balance content freshness with evergreen authority, scale content production while maintaining quality, and compete in highly saturated niches.
Core Foundation Elements:
| Challenge | Impact | Strategic Solution |
|---|---|---|
| Content Cannibalization | Multiple articles competing for same keywords | Topic cluster strategy with clear content hierarchies |
| Freshness vs Authority | New content may outrank established pages | Content refresh cycles and update strategies |
| Scale vs Quality | High publishing volume can dilute quality signals | Editorial standards and quality gate processes |
| Competition Density | Saturated niches with established players | Long-tail keyword targeting and niche specialization |

Publishers face unique performance challenges due to advertising, social media widgets, and comment systems. Site speed directly impacts both user engagement and search rankings.
| Optimization Area | Publisher Impact | Implementation Strategy |
|---|---|---|
| Image Optimization | Reduces load times for image-heavy articles | WebP format, lazy loading, responsive images |
| Ad Load Optimization | Balances revenue with user experience | Asynchronous ad loading, header bidding optimization |
| CDN Implementation | Improves global content delivery | Static asset distribution, edge caching |
| Database Optimization | Handles high-volume content queries | Query optimization, caching layers |

Structured data helps publishers achieve rich snippets and enhanced search appearances, improving click-through rates and visibility.
Priority Schema Implementations:
Proper structured data implementation requires attention to detail and regular validation.
| Schema Type | Key Properties | Publisher Benefits |
|---|---|---|
| Article | headline, author, datePublished, image | Enhanced search appearance, author recognition |
| Review | reviewRating, author, itemReviewed | Star ratings in search results |
| FAQ | question, acceptedAnswer | Featured snippet opportunities |
| HowTo | name, step, tool, supply | Rich snippet with step-by-step display |

How do publishers avoid content cannibalization?
Publishers prevent cannibalization through topic cluster strategy, clear keyword mapping, and content consolidation. Use canonical tags, internal linking hierarchy, and content audits to ensure each page targets unique search intent. Consider merging similar articles and implementing proper redirects when necessary.

How should publishers handle duplicate content across categories?
Use canonical tags to specify preferred versions, avoid cross-posting identical content, and create unique angles for similar topics. Implement proper URL structure and category organization to prevent duplication. Consider using noindex tags for tag pages and author archives if they create duplicate content issues.
